Which has a larger context window, Italia 70B Instruct or Llama Guard 4 12B?

Llama Guard 4 12B supports 164K tokens, while Italia 70B Instruct supports 131K tokens. That gap matters most for long documents, large codebases, retrieval-heavy agents, and conversations where earlier context must remain visible.

Is Italia 70B Instruct or Llama Guard 4 12B open source?

Italia 70B Instruct is listed under Proprietary. Llama Guard 4 12B is listed under Open Source. License labels affect whether you can self-host, redistribute weights, or rely only on hosted APIs, so confirm the upstream license before deployment.

Which is better for structured outputs, Italia 70B Instruct or Llama Guard 4 12B?

Llama Guard 4 12B has the clearer documented structured outputs signal in this comparison. If structured outputs is mission-critical, validate it against the provider endpoint because model-level support and API-level exposure can differ.

Where can I run Italia 70B Instruct and Llama Guard 4 12B?

Italia 70B Instruct is available on the tracked providers still being sourced. Llama Guard 4 12B is available on NVIDIA NIM, Replicate API, and OpenRouter. Provider coverage can affect latency, region availability, compliance posture, and fallback options.
